The request for the removal of president Julio Casares from São Paulo received new updates this Friday (26). The president of the club’s Deliberative Council, Olten Ayres de Abreu Júnior, responded to the request filed by council members for the impeachment of the president and called an extraordinary meeting.
On that occasion, members of the opposition to the current administration managed to collect 57 signatures, enough for the impeachment motion to go to a vote at the club. Thirteen of those signatures came from members aligned with the Tricolor’s current administration.
Now, as confirmed by AVANTE MEU TRICOLOR, Olten Ayres has called a meeting of the Advisory Council to discuss the impeachment of Julio Casares. This body is composed of former São Paulo presidents and members of the Deliberative Council.
The names are: Carlos Augusto de Barros e Silva, Carlos Miguel Castex Aidar, Fernando José P. Casal de Rey, Ives Gandra da Silva Martins, José Carlos Ferreira Alves, José Eduardo Mesquita Pimenta, Julio Cesar Casares, Marcelo Abranches Pupo Barboza, Milton José Neves, Olten Ayres de Abreu Junior, Paulo Amaral Vasconcelos, and Paulo Planet Buarque.
The meeting, which will not include any kind of vote on whether or not Casares will step down, is scheduled for January 12, 2026. At this meeting, the topic of impeachment will be discussed among the club’s ‘upper echelon’.
This process is provided for in Article 79 of São Paulo’s Statute and is required for the removal of any president.
“To revoke the mandate of any member of the Elected Board, the President of the Deliberative Council, upon receiving a written and substantiated request to this effect, shall call, after previously consulting the Advisory Council, an Extraordinary Meeting of the Deliberative Council, in which the accused will be assured full defense, as provided by the Internal Regulations of SPFC,” states the document.
After this meeting, the Deliberative Council is then required to convene for a vote on the impeachment. Finally, the removal of Julio Casares will be finalized if two-thirds of the council members approve, that is, 170 out of the current 256 members of the Tricolor.
